How to Troubleshoot WordPress Download Plugin Not Working Issue

WordPress plugins are an essential part of any WordPress website, providing additional functionality that would otherwise not be available with just the core WordPress installation. However, sometimes you may encounter issues with a plugin, particularly when it comes to downloading and installing it on your WordPress website. In this article, we will discuss some possible reasons why your WordPress download plugin is not working and how to troubleshoot it.

Common Causes of WordPress Download Plugin Not Working

  1. Incompatible Plugin Version: The first thing to check is whether the plugin you are trying to download is compatible with your current WordPress version. Some plugins may not work with older or newer versions of WordPress.

  2. Server Configuration Issues: Another common issue is related to server configuration. Sometimes, servers configured with specific settings may not allow users to download files from certain URLs or domains, preventing you from downloading a plugin.

  3. Plugin Conflict: If you have many plugins installed on your WordPress website, it's possible that there is a conflict between one or more of them that's causing issues with downloading and installing new plugins.

How to Resolve WordPress Download Plugin Not Working Issue

  1. Check Compatibility: The first step in troubleshooting this issue is to check whether the plugin version is compatible with your current WordPress version. You can check this by visiting the plugin's official website or plugin repository.

  2. Check Server Configuration: If the plugin is compatible with your WordPress version, the next step is to ensure that your server is configured correctly to allow downloading of files from the plugin's URL or domain. Contact your hosting provider to check server settings or try downloading the plugin from a different internet connection.

  3. Deactivate Conflicting Plugins: As mentioned earlier, plugin conflicts can prevent you from downloading new plugins. Deactivate all plugins and try downloading the plugin again. If the download works, reactivate each plugin one by one to identify the conflicting plugin(s).

  4. Manually Install Plugin: If the above steps do not work, try downloading and installing the plugin manually. To do this, download the plugin .zip file and then upload it to your WordPress website using the plugin upload feature in the WordPress dashboard.

In conclusion, WordPress download plugin not working issue can be due to various reasons such as plugin incompatibility, server configuration issues, and plugin conflicts. By following the above troubleshooting steps, you can resolve this issue and enjoy the new features and functionality provided by the plugin.
